  19. I only use circle hooks on my dropshot rigs. I did really well with them this past Sunday. As soon as the fish take the bait and start swimming off, i just lift my rod slightly and start reeling. Then the hook just does the work. My circle hooks are Eagle Claw 3/0 size though. Even the small bass doesn't seem to have problems with that size.
